Pawan Kalyan: The Power Star of Telugu Cinema

Pawan Kalyan, often referred to as “Power Star,” is a multifaceted personality known for his acting, directing, and political endeavors. Born on September 2, 1971, in Bapatla, Andhra Pradesh, he is the younger brother of renowned actor Chiranjeevi. Pawan made his acting debut in 1996 with the film *Akkada Ammayi Ikkada Abbayi*, but it was his role in *Tholi Prema* (1998) that catapulted him to stardom. His unique style, dialogue delivery, and ability to connect with the audience have made him a beloved figure in Telugu cinema.

Over the years, Pawan has starred in numerous successful films, including *Gabbar Singh*, *Attarintiki Daredi*, and *Sardar Gabbar Singh*. His films often blend action, romance, and drama, resonating with a wide audience. Beyond acting, Pawan Kalyan is also a politician, having founded the Jana Sena Party in 2014, which aims to address the issues faced by the people of Andhra Pradesh and Telangana.

Kangana Ranaut: The Queen of Bollywood

Kangana Ranaut, born on March 23, 1987, in Bhambla, Himachal Pradesh, is one of the most talented and versatile actresses in Bollywood. She made her acting debut in 2006 with *Gangster*, which earned her critical acclaim and established her as a force to be reckoned with in the industry. Known for her strong performances and willingness to take on challenging roles, Kangana has received several awards, including multiple National Film Awards.

Her notable films include *Queen*, *Tanu Weds Manu*, and *Manikarnika: The Queen of Jhansi*. Kangana is not only an actress but also a filmmaker, having directed and starred in *Manikarnika* and *Emergency*, a film based on the controversial period of Indian history during the Emergency declared by then-Prime Minister Indira Gandhi. Her bold personality and outspoken nature have made her a prominent figure in discussions about women’s rights and social issues in India.

The Intersection of Their Careers

The recent interactions between Pawan Kalyan and Kangana Ranaut have highlighted their mutual respect and admiration for each other’s work. During a promotional event for his film *Hari Hara Veera Mallu*, Pawan Kalyan was asked to choose a dream co-star among several leading actresses, including Kareena Kapoor and Priyanka Chopra. He chose Kangana, praising her strength as an actor and specifically referencing her portrayal of Indira Gandhi in *Emergency*. This acknowledgment from a fellow actor of Pawan’s stature speaks volumes about Kangana’s talent and the impact of her recent work.

Kangana responded positively to Pawan’s comments, sharing a clip from the interview on her social media with affectionate emojis, indicating her appreciation for his words.  The Films: *Hari Hara Veera Mallu* and *Emergency*

*Hari Hara Veera Mallu* is a period drama set in the Mughal Empire, featuring Pawan Kalyan in the titular role of Veera Mallu, an outlaw who stands against the empire. The film, directed by Krish Jagarlamudi, has generated significant buzz due to its grand scale and Pawan’s powerful performance. The film also stars Nidhhi Agerwal and Bobby Deol, adding to its appeal. With a storyline that intertwines history and fiction, *Hari Hara Veera Mallu* aims to captivate audiences with its rich narrative and visual spectacle.

On the other hand, Kangana’s *Emergency* delves into a critical period in Indian history, exploring the political turmoil and societal changes during the Emergency from 1975 to 1977. Kangana not only stars as Indira Gandhi but also takes on the role of director, showcasing her multifaceted talent. The film has sparked discussions about its historical significance and the portrayal of political figures, further solidifying Kangana’s position as a bold storyteller in Indian cinema.
